Output 43a5ea95bea10c1d690d78eb02a3445c38f99af746a1aa38c310fcdb596bf1eb:1

value
344787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96ded7dfb511dba63cef04da0927a823c0623214 OP_EQUAL
address
3FSkEjqAk3oesfqH1eah5Y8qwSv9TD4abG
transaction
43a5ea95bea10c1d690d78eb02a3445c38f99af746a1aa38c310fcdb596bf1eb
spent
true